One of the earliest multiplayer successes was SOCOM: U.S. Navy SEALs on the PlayStation 2. It combined tactical squad-based gameplay with intense online battles, building a strong community of players and showing that consoles could handle serious competitive play.

Fast forward to the PlayStation 4 era, and Rocket League emerged as a breakout hit, blending soccer with high-octane vehicles. Its fast-paced, skill-based gameplay is easy to pick up but hard to master, and the cross-platform support means players can compete with friends no matter what device they use.

The Call of Duty franchise, especially Call of Duty: Modern Warfare and Warzone, have defined modern multiplayer shooters on PlayStation. Their polished mechanics, vast player bases, and constant updates keep the gameplay fresh and competitive.

For those who prefer cooperative multiplayer, Destiny 2 offers an evolving online world full of raids, strikes, and player-vs-player combat. The social hubs and guild-like clans foster long-term player engagement and teamwork.

PlayStation exclusives like Gran Turismo Sport introduced robust multiplayer racing with ranked matches and global tournaments, while LittleBigPlanet provided creative multiplayer fun with its user-generated content and charming platforming.
